Snake Xenia, was one of the most popular 90's games. Popularized by the widely famous Nokia phones, people would go on about hours listening to the 8 bit jingles and collecting fruits to aid their snake in it's growing.
Pacman, a Original available on Nintendo and later on arcade consoles became an instant hit with families and children for it's simplicity in rules and vibing 8 bit jingles. You had to collect all the points laid around the map whilst avoiding the enemy pacmans. This fun and interactive game is still popular and even used as a fun exercise to improve analytical and critical thinking abilities.
